DNA: GTACGCGTATAC CGACATTC mRNA: 4. what … cunningham insurance agencyWebThe endoplasmic reticulum (ER) ( Figure 4.18) is a series of interconnected membranous sacs and tubules that collectively modifies proteins and synthesizes lipids. However, these two functions take place in separate areas of the ER: the rough ER and the smooth ER, respectively. There are several organelles that all... easy baked mackerel recipeWebThe organelle responsible for making lipids -- which includes cholesterol, fatty acids and phospholipids -- is the smooth endoplasmic reticulum. Not surprisingly then, the key structural feature of cells that synthesize lipids is an abundance of the SER.
